The keyword “Upstore search” often leads to confusion because Upstore itself does not provide a native, platform-wide search feature. Unlike services such as Google Drive or Dropbox that include robust internal search capabilities, Upstore functions primarily as a file storage and sharing service rather than a searchable database. Uploaded files are not indexed within Upstore for public search, which means that you cannot simply type a keyword into Upstore's homepage to find files.

Upstore.net is a popular cloud-based file storage and sharing platform designed for individuals and professionals to securely upload, store, and distribute documents, photos, videos, and other digital files. As a centralized repository, Upstore provides a space to manage content remotely, allowing users to rename, delete, or share files via unique links.
